/[radius]/radius/ChangeLog
ViewVC logotype

Diff of /radius/ChangeLog

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1.408 by gray, Mon Nov 3 13:26:09 2003 UTC revision 1.409 by gray, Mon Nov 3 21:45:27 2003 UTC
# Line 1  Line 1 
1  2003-11-03  Sergey Poznyakoff  2003-11-03  Sergey Poznyakoff
2    
3            Two more bugfixes. Thanks Maurice for pointing.
4            
5            * lib/dict.c (_dict_attribute): Bugfix.
6            * radiusd/config.y: Bugfix.
7    
8    2003-11-03  Sergey Poznyakoff
9    
10          * radiusd/acct.c (write_detail): Minor change.          * radiusd/acct.c (write_detail): Minor change.
11          * radiusd/auth.c (rad_auth_init): Changed 2nd arg to write_detail.          * radiusd/auth.c (rad_auth_init): Changed 2nd arg to write_detail.
12          (sfn_init): Return MSG_ACCESS_DENIED if an invalid username was          (sfn_init): Return MSG_ACCESS_DENIED if an invalid username was
# Line 13  Line 20 
20    
21  2003-11-02  Sergey Poznyakoff  2003-11-02  Sergey Poznyakoff
22    
23            * include/radius.h (struct radius_req): New member remote_auth.
24            Keeps the authenticator used to forward the request to the
25            remote host.
26            (rad_clt_decrypt_pairlist): New function.
27            * lib/client.c (rad_clt_decrypt_pairlist): New function.
28            (rad_clt_recv): Save the pointer to the shared secret in the
29            returned RADIUS_REQ.
30            * lib/cryptpass.c (encrypt_tunnel_password)
31            (crypt_tunnel_password): Fixed to comply to RFC 2868. Thanks
32            Maurice.
33            * raddb/dict/tunnel (Tunnel-Password): Marked with P
34            * radiusd/proxy.c: Provide for proper recoding of the encrypted
35            attributes.
36            * radiusd/testsuite/proxy/Makefile.am: Added dict.tunnel
37            * radiusd/testsuite/raddb/Makefile.am: Likewise
38            * radiusd/testsuite/raddb/users.in: New test user 'tunnel'
39            * radiusd/testsuite/radiusd/proxy.exp: Added test for proxying
40            Tunnel-Password pair.
41            * radiusd/testsuite/radiusd/radiusd.exp: Added Tunnel-Password
42            pair test.
43            * radtest/main.c (radtest_send): Decrypt the returned pair list.
44            * radiusd/rewrite.y (debug_print_mtxlist): Fixed coredumps.
45            
46    2003-11-02  Sergey Poznyakoff
47    
48          * include/radius.h (rad_clt_encrypt_pairlist): New function.          * include/radius.h (rad_clt_encrypt_pairlist): New function.
49          * lib/client.c: Likewise.          * lib/client.c: Likewise.
50          * include/radiusd.h (radius_decrypt_request_pairs): Changed proto.          * include/radiusd.h (radius_decrypt_request_pairs): Changed proto.

Legend:
Removed from v.1.408  
changed lines
  Added in v.1.409

savannah-hackers-public@gnu.org
ViewVC Help
Powered by ViewVC 1.1.26